 Robert Barisford also known as Bobby Brown well known for his song writing and crazy dance moves. Brown started his solo career in 1987 with a line of billboards top 10 hits along with a Grammy from his his album and hit "My prerogative". Brown big break started a the tender age of 11 with a group called New Edition making hits like "Mr. Telephone man", "Cool it Now" and "Candy Girl" just to name a few. But like everyone figured the group would not last for many years Brown hop in and out of the group not know what he wanted to do. After several years brown finally made it official and made an solo album called "king of stage" in 1986 even though it had many hits brown's second album is what really made him get to stardom. Recording with producers like L.A Reid, Teddy Riley and Babyface just to name a few. It seemed like 1990 and straight through went down hill for Brown with the use of drugs and being charged with abusing his ex wife Whitney. In 2003 through 2004 Brown was arrested and had an misdemeanor for striking Houston while under the influence and in late 2007 Houston filed for a divorced and got custody of their then 14 year old daughter.
